Alice Mitchell 1744–1766 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 5 Apr 1744

Birth Location: Bridgewater, Plymouth, Massachusetts, USA

Death Date: 2 November 1766

Death Location: East Bridgewater, Plymouth County, Massachusetts, USA

Father: Col. Jr

Mother: Elizabeth Cushing

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Alice Mitchell was born in 1744 in Bridgewater, Plymouth, Massachusetts, USA, the child of Col Edward Mitchell Jr And Elizabeth Cushing. Alice Mitchell passed away in 1766 in East Bridgewater, Plymouth County, Massachusetts, USA.
